(-) Description

Title :  MAGEE1 A CANCER RELATED PROTEIN
 
Authors :  V. Niranjan, R. Mahmood, N. Kapil, J. Reddy, D. Sivakumar
Date :  27 May 06  (Deposition) - 04 Jul 06  (Release) - 04 Jul 06  (Revision)
Method :  THEORETICAL MODEL
Resolution :  NOT APPLICABLE
Chains :  Theor. Model :  A
Keywords :  Magee1 (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  V. Niranjan, R. Mahmood, N. Kapil, J. Reddy, D. Sivakumar
Magee1 A Cancer Related Protein
To Be Published
PubMed: search
(for further references see the PDB file header)

(-) Compounds

Molecule 1 - MELANOMA-ASSOCIATED ANTIGEN E1
    ChainsA
    Organism CommonHUMAN
    Organism ScientificHOMO SAPIENS
    SynonymMAGE-E1 ANTIGEN, HEPATOCELLULAR CARCINOMA- ASSOCIATED PROTEIN 1

(-) Gene Ontology  (10, 10)

Theoretical Model(hide GO term definitions)
Chain A   (MAGE1_HUMAN | Q9HCI5)
molecular function
    GO:0005515    protein binding    Interacting selectively and non-covalently with any protein or protein complex (a complex of two or more proteins that may include other nonprotein molecules).
biological process
    GO:0008150    biological_process    Any process specifically pertinent to the functioning of integrated living units: cells, tissues, organs, and organisms. A process is a collection of molecular events with a defined beginning and end.
cellular component
    GO:0005737    cytoplasm    All of the contents of a cell excluding the plasma membrane and nucleus, but including other subcellular structures.
    GO:0030425    dendrite    A neuron projection that has a short, tapering, often branched, morphology, receives and integrates signals from other neurons or from sensory stimuli, and conducts a nerve impulse towards the axon or the cell body. In most neurons, the impulse is conveyed from dendrites to axon via the cell body, but in some types of unipolar neuron, the impulse does not travel via the cell body.
    GO:0016010    dystrophin-associated glycoprotein complex    A multiprotein complex that forms a strong mechanical link between the cytoskeleton and extracellular matrix; typical of, but not confined to, muscle cells. The complex is composed of transmembrane, cytoplasmic, and extracellular proteins, including dystrophin, sarcoglycans, dystroglycan, dystrobrevins, syntrophins, sarcospan, caveolin-3, and NO synthase.
    GO:0016020    membrane    A lipid bilayer along with all the proteins and protein complexes embedded in it an attached to it.
    GO:0005634    nucleus    A membrane-bounded organelle of eukaryotic cells in which chromosomes are housed and replicated. In most cells, the nucleus contains all of the cell's chromosomes except the organellar chromosomes, and is the site of RNA synthesis and processing. In some species, or in specialized cell types, RNA metabolism or DNA replication may be absent.
    GO:0048471    perinuclear region of cytoplasm    Cytoplasm situated near, or occurring around, the nucleus.
    GO:0005886    plasma membrane    The membrane surrounding a cell that separates the cell from its external environment. It consists of a phospholipid bilayer and associated proteins.
    GO:0045211    postsynaptic membrane    A specialized area of membrane facing the presynaptic membrane on the tip of the nerve ending and separated from it by a minute cleft (the synaptic cleft). Neurotransmitters cross the synaptic cleft and transmit the signal to the postsynaptic membrane.
